Genetic Lineage of Dagwood
Tropicana Cookies x Mandarin Sunset
Dagwood is the offspring of two flavorful heavyweights:
-
Tropicana Cookies – Known for bold citrus notes and a sativa-leaning head high
-
Mandarin Sunset – Offers sweet, spicy aroma and balanced effects
This parentage explains Dagwood’s rich aroma, bright visuals, and calm-yet-alert high.

Potency and Cannabinoid Content
Average THC Levels
Dagwood typically clocks in at THC levels between 18% and 23%, offering a moderate potency that’s manageable for most users while still delivering noticeable effects.
Other Cannabinoids
Trace amounts of CBG and CBC may be present, contributing to mood balance, anti-anxiety effects, and the entourage effect.

Growing Dagwood Strain
Ideal Conditions and Setup
Dagwood grows best:
-
Indoors with temperature control
-
With low humidity to preserve resin and prevent mold
-
Under full-spectrum LEDs or sunlight for color expression
Flowering Period and Yields
-
Flowering time: 8–9 weeks
-
Yields: Moderate (indoor: ~400g/m²; outdoor: ~500g/plant)
Prune early to improve air circulation and maximize yield.
